Why Houston Plumbers Struggle to Rank on Google

Houston’s sheer size creates a layered search landscape that most plumbing websites aren’t built to handle. A homeowner in Meyerland searches differently than one in Katy or Cypress. Google treats these as distinct local queries, and a single generic homepage rarely satisfies all of them. Most plumbing sites make three common mistakes:

– They target one broad keyword (“Houston plumber”) instead of building relevance across the neighborhoods they actually serve.

– Their Google Business Profile is incomplete, lacks service area coverage, and has too few recent reviews to compete with established players.

– Their website loads slowly on mobile — a critical failure when a panicked homeowner with a burst pipe is searching from their phone at 11 p.m.

Each of these gaps is fixable. But fixing them requires a deliberate, city-specific strategy, not a generic SEO template.

What Does Local SEO Actually Mean for a Houston Plumber?

Local SEO is the practice of optimizing your online presence so your business appears prominently when people nearby search for your services. For a plumbing company, that means winning placement in three areas: the Google Map Pack (those top three listings with a map), the organic blue-link results beneath it, and voice search queries like “Who’s the best plumber in Bellaire, Texas?”

Google Business Profile Optimization

Your Google Business Profile is the single most leveraged asset in local search. A fully optimized profile — with accurate service areas covering neighborhoods like Montrose, Spring Branch, and Clear Lake, up-to-date business hours, photo-rich posts, and a consistent stream of 4- and 5-star reviews — dramatically improves your chances of appearing in the Map Pack. Houston’s flooding history means seasonal spikes in demand for drain cleaning and pipe repair; your profile should reflect those services prominently so Google surfaces you during high-intent searches.

On-Page SEO and Service Area Pages

Every major service area your crew drives to deserves its own optimized page. A plumbing company based in Pearland that also serves Friendswood, League City, and Missouri City should have distinct, well-written pages for each location. These pages aren’t keyword-stuffed duplicates — they answer specific questions relevant to each community, reference local landmarks and infrastructure quirks, and build the geographic relevance Google needs to rank you there.

Houston’s Unique Market Conditions Make Local Signals Critical

Houston’s clay-heavy soil causes significant pipe movement and foundation shifts — a well-known issue for homeowners in older neighborhoods like Garden Oaks and Oak Forest. This creates consistent search demand for slab leak detection and pipe rerouting. Plumbing companies that publish genuinely useful content about these Houston-specific issues earn topical authority that generic competitors simply don’t have.

The area also experiences intense freeze events — the 2021 winter storm left countless Houston homeowners dealing with burst pipes — and annual flooding tied to Gulf Coast hurricane season. Plumbers who create content addressing these real, recurring scenarios signal to Google that they understand the local market. That contextual depth is part of what separates a page-one ranking from a page-three afterthought.

Nearby cities like Sugar Land, Pasadena, and Conroe each represent real service area opportunities. Building out structured content for those communities — while keeping your core Houston presence strong — expands your total addressable search footprint without diluting your local authority.

Technical SEO: The Foundation Most Plumbing Sites Are Missing

Content and citations won’t move the needle if your website has foundational problems. Google’s crawlers need to be able to read, index, and understand your site before ranking it. For plumbing companies, the most common technical issues include:

– Pages that load in over four seconds on mobile — unacceptable when emergency plumbing searches peak on smartphones.

– Missing or duplicate title tags and meta descriptions that leave Google guessing what each page is about.

– No schema markup, which means your business hours, service types, and reviews aren’t being communicated to search engines in a structured format.

Fixing these issues is table stakes. Once the technical foundation is solid, every other SEO effort compounds faster.

Link Building and Citation Authority for Houston Plumbers

Google still weighs the quality and quantity of websites linking to yours as a trust signal. For local plumbing companies, the most valuable links come from local sources: Houston-area home improvement directories, the Greater Houston Builders Association, neighborhood association websites, and local news features. A mention in the Houston Chronicle’s home improvement section, for example, carries far more local authority than a generic directory listing.

Consistent business citations — your name, address, and phone number listed identically across Yelp, Angi, HomeAdvisor, and industry-specific directories — also reinforce your legitimacy in Google’s local algorithm. Inconsistent citations (a suite number missing here, an old phone number there) quietly suppress rankings.

How Long Does SEO Take for a Houston Plumber?

Honest answer: most plumbing companies start seeing meaningful movement in three to six months, with compounding results through the first year. The timeline depends on how competitive the specific search terms are, how much work needs to be done on the existing site, and how aggressively the campaign is executed. Emergency plumbing terms in central Houston are among the most competitive in the city. Hyper-local terms — “plumber in Humble, TX” or “drain cleaning in Stafford” — often move faster because fewer competitors have invested in those pages.

SEO is not a one-time fix. The plumbing companies that consistently dominate Houston search results are the ones that treat local SEO as an ongoing investment, not a project they did once three years ago. Frequently Asked Questions: SEO for Houston Plumbing Companies

How much does SEO cost for a plumbing company in Houston?

Local SEO for a Houston plumber typically ranges from $800 to $3,000 per month depending on the scope of the campaign, how competitive your target keywords are, and how many service areas you want to rank in. Larger companies targeting multiple Houston-area cities will invest more than a single-location shop focused on one neighborhood.

Do I need a separate page for each city I serve?

Yes — and they need to be genuinely unique. Google penalizes thin, duplicate location pages. Each city or neighborhood page should answer real questions about that community, reference local context, and provide enough distinct content to justify its existence. A well-built Sugar Land plumbing page should not read like a copy-paste of your main Houston page.

How important are Google reviews for plumbers in Houston?

Extremely. Review volume, recency, and response rate are all factors in local ranking. Houston homeowners also read reviews before calling — a plumber with 12 reviews is rarely chosen over one with 150. A consistent review generation strategy, including follow-up texts or emails after each job, is one of the highest-ROI habits a plumbing company can build.

Can I do SEO myself, or do I need an agency?

You can handle the basics — keeping your Google Business Profile updated, responding to reviews, publishing occasional content. But competing for high-value Houston search terms against established plumbing companies requires technical expertise, link-building relationships, and ongoing optimization that most business owners don’t have time to manage. An experienced agency compresses the timeline and avoids costly mistakes.

What’s the difference between SEO and Google Ads for plumbers?

Google Ads puts you at the top of results immediately but stops the moment you stop paying. SEO builds organic visibility that compounds over time and doesn’t charge you per click. Most successful Houston plumbing companies use both — Ads for immediate lead flow, SEO for long-term cost efficiency. How do I know if my current SEO is working?

Track rankings for your core service keywords, monitor your Google Business Profile’s call and direction request data, and measure organic traffic through Google Analytics. If those numbers have been flat or declining for more than six months, your current approach isn’t working — regardless of what you’re being told.
